==Design==
The Prison Keeper is a large, seemingly mechanical Heartless that seems to be made out of metal, and is thus predominantly shades of grey, black, and silver. Its large, egg-shaped head has a jagged, gaping maw and glowing eyes that are triangular spirals. Its face is not one uniform color, and seems to have been broken, as there is a crack between its eyes that appears to have been stitched or stapled back together. It has a long, twisted antenna sprouting out of the top of its head that appears to be wrapped in bandages. Its Heartless emblem is at the base of this antenna. Its long arms are connected to the bottom of its head, are mostly covered by metal "sleeves", and its hands seem to be made of bone. A large, metal cage holding the three children is suspended by a wire that hangs from the bottom of the Prison Keeper. The cage resembles the one that [[Lock, Shock, and Barrel]] use to travel Oogie's Manor in ''The Nightmare Before Christmas'' and ''Kingdom Hearts''. There is a large, black knob on either side of the Heartless's head that seems to operate a the winch at the Prison Keeper’s base.

In ''Kingdom Hearts II Final Mix'', the Prison Keeper is brighter-colored, with a copper and gold cage, bright yellow hands, and turquoise arms.
